Joint pain (sharp, on movement)
Sharp joint pain on movement is a sudden, stabbing sensation that occurs when you move or load a joint. It often signals mechanical issues like cartilage damage, loose bodies, or acute inflammation. Ayurvedic treatment focuses on reducing inflammation and restoring smooth joint function.

When to Seek Urgent Medical Care for Joint pain (sharp, on movement)
These signs may indicate a serious problem — don't wait, seek medical care right away:
- Sharp pain with joint locking or giving way
- Inability to bear weight on the affected joint
- Sudden onset after injury with rapid swelling
